The national election will see over 26 million registered voters head to the polls on 8 May and in the lead up to the event, political parties are making use of all sorts of campaign antics to ensure a mark is placed next to their party’s symbol. The Democratic Alliance, for example, has accused the ANC of orchestrating violent protests in DA-led areas while analysts have criticized the ANC in Gauteng for suspending E-toll debt collection as a move to win the party votes.
Political Analyst, Daniel Silke joins Business Day TV to talk about the electioneering tactics that various political parties are using ahead of the national election.
